About this clipart
The tablet is made of fired clay and bears multiple lines of wedge-shaped cuneiform characters pressed into its surface using a stylus. Its irregular edges and visible wear suggest it was excavated from an archaeological site in southern Iraq, possibly Ur or Uruk. The script likely dates to the Early Dynastic or Akkadian period (c. 2600-2200 BCE), reflecting bureaucratic or ritual record-keeping practices of the time.
